What are the opposite words for poly-chromic?
The term "poly-chromic" refers to the presence of multiple colors or hues in an object or surface. Some antonyms for the word "poly-chromic" could be monochromatic, uniform, dull, or plain. Monochromatic suggests a single color or shade, whereas uniform implies a consistent color throughout. Dull or plain suggest a lack of vibrancy or color variation. Other antonyms could include colorless, pale, drab, or washed-out. When describing a specific object or surface, using one of these antonyms can help convey a different and contrasting visual effect.
